Outstanding average bench

The Nvme WDC PC SN530 SDBPNPZ-256G-1006 256GB averaged 23.4% higher than the peak scores attained by the group leaders. This is an excellent result which ranks the Nvme WDC PC SN530 SDBPNPZ-256G-1006 256GB near the top of the comparison list.

Terrible consistency

The range of scores (95th - 5th percentile) for the Nvme WDC PC SN530 SDBPNPZ-256G-1006 256GB is 115%. This is a particularly wide range which indicates that the Nvme WDC PC SN530 SDBPNPZ-256G-1006 256GB performs inconsistently under varying real world conditions.

Welcome to our 2.5" and M.2 SSD comparison. We calculate effective speed for both SATA and NVMe drives based on real world performance then adjust by current prices per GB to yield a value for money rating. Our calculated values are checked against thousands of individual user ratings. The customizable table below combines these factors to bring you the definitive list of top SSDs. [SSDrivePro]
